Variable Column

Hi everybody !

 

Here is my table : 

Capture.PNG

 I want to create a measure with another value named A  (which is constant) divide by my second column named B. In fact, I have a slicer with each dates but when I diselected my date, there is All. 

I want when All appear on my slicer, a measure with A divide by the last B here 615.

 

So I try : 

C = IF (
DISTINCTCOUNT ( 'Données'[Date] ) = 1;
SUM ( B);
Lastnonblank(B;"")
))

 

 

It worked but it divide A by 600 (november 2017), so strange..

Hi @DavidB023

I make a test with your data on my site.

Create measures

Measure = CALCULATE(LASTDATE(Sheet1[year]),ALL(Sheet1))
Measure 2 = CALCULATE(LASTNONBLANK(Sheet1[B],1),FILTER(ALL(Sheet1),[year]=[Measure]))
Measure 3 = DIVIDE(615,[Measure 2])

Hi @v-juanli-msft,

Thanks a lot for your solution ! 

Finally I used your Measure and Measure2 and I inject in :

Measure3 = DIVIDE( A ;

IF( DISTINCTCOUNT ( 'Sheet1'[year] ) = 1 ;
B ; 
[Mesure2]
))

 

It works like I want,
